Dow PAPI™ 94 Polymeric MDI
Categories: Fluid; Polymer

Material Notes: PAPI™ 901 polymeric MDI is a polymethylene polyphenylisocyanate that contains MDI. This products low viscosity, low functionality, increased diphenylmethane diisocyanate content and increased percentage of orthopara isomers make PAPI™ 94 polymeric MDI highly versatile. This product also offers delayed gel times, which results in better flow into molds for semi-flexible and integral skin foams.

Physical PropertiesOriginal ValueComments
Density 1.234 g/cc
Viscosity 50 cP
Viscosity Measurement <= 5.0[cps/mo.] Viscosity growth
Molecular Weight 290 g/mol
Vapor Pressure <= 1.30e-8 bar
 
Chemical PropertiesOriginal ValueComments
Acid Value 0.030HCl content, %
 
Thermal PropertiesOriginal ValueComments
CTE, linear 648 µin/in-°F
@Temperature 20.0 °C
Specific Heat Capacity 1.80 J/g-°C
Thermal Conductivity 0.000300 cal cm/sec-cm²-°C
Boiling Point 330 °C
Decomposition Temperature 230 °C
Flash Point >= 400 °FASTM D93 Closed Cup
 
Descriptive Properties
NCO Content %32
